What Outdoor Play Equipment Manufacturers Actually Cover
| Phase / Feature | What It Specifically Covers |
|---|---|
| Site Planning | Soil analysis, drainage assessment, and space utilization |
| Design Engineering | Structural load calculations and child-safe layouts |
| Safety Compliance | ASTM, EN1176, and regional playground safety standards |
| Material Selection | UV-resistant metals, HDPE panels, anti-rust coatings |
| Manufacturing | Precision fabrication and stress-tested assembly |
| Installation | Foundation work, anchoring systems, and leveling |
| Maintenance Planning | Inspection schedules and replacement forecasting |
| Customization | Theme-based adventure play equipment and branding |
| Accessibility | Inclusive designs for differently abled children |
| Lifecycle Support | Repair services and scalability upgrades |
Therefore, the role of outdoor play equipment suppliers extends far beyond manufacturing alone. The best companies manage the entire operational journey, from planning through lifecycle maintenance.
The Gap Nobody Is Talking About
Most buyers assume that playground durability depends mainly on material thickness. That assumption is incomplete.
In reality, the biggest failure point in many park play systems is poor installation engineering combined with environmental exposure miscalculations. For example, playgrounds installed in high-humidity regions without corrosion-resistant treatment often experience structural degradation within 3–5 years, even when premium steel is used.
Furthermore, many outdoor playground manufacturers advertise compliance certifications without explaining whether those standards apply to the full installation system or only individual components.
This creates a hidden operational risk: buyers believe they are purchasing certified safe playground structures, while critical anchoring and impact-absorption systems remain unverified.
The implication is clear: buyers must evaluate engineering methodology, not just product catalogs.

Evaluation Checklist
- Safety Certification Verification — Confirm whether the entire system meets playground safety standards, not just individual parts.
- Material Durability Testing — Request corrosion, UV, and stress-resistance reports before purchase.
- Installation Engineering — Ensure foundation and anchoring systems are professionally designed.
- Maintenance Accessibility — Choose systems with easily replaceable components.
- Scalability Planning — Verify whether future expansion is operationally feasible.
- Weather Adaptability — Assess suitability for humidity, heat, and rainfall conditions.
- Supplier Experience — Evaluate past projects in schools, parks, and real estate developments.
- Warranty Structure — Review coverage periods and service response commitments.
Mistakes to Avoid
Choosing Based Only on Price
Many buyers focus exclusively on initial procurement budgets. However, low-cost playground systems frequently create significantly higher maintenance liabilities later.
Ignoring Safety Surfacing
Even premium playground structures become dangerous when impact attenuation systems are poorly designed or absent.
Overlooking Environmental Conditions
Outdoor play equipment installed in coastal or high-humidity regions requires specialized anti-corrosion treatment.
Selecting Non-Scalable Designs
Fixed playground systems often become operational bottlenecks during future expansion phases.
Skipping Maintenance Forecasting
Without preventive maintenance planning, playground reliability declines much faster than expected.

Q: How do I choose durable outdoor playground equipment for schools and parks?
A: Start by evaluating corrosion resistance, structural certifications, and installation methodology. Additionally, review maintenance forecasting and supplier experience with high-traffic environments. Durable systems usually include galvanized steel, UV-protected coatings, and professionally engineered anchoring systems.
Q: What certifications should playground equipment manufacturers have in India?
A: Reputable playground equipment manufacturers generally align with ASTM, EN1176, or equivalent safety frameworks. Furthermore, buyers should verify whether installation practices also comply with impact and accessibility standards. Documentation transparency is extremely important during procurement.
Q: What is the average lifespan of commercial outdoor playground equipment?
A: High-quality commercial playground equipment typically lasts between 10–20 years depending on maintenance quality, environmental exposure, and usage intensity. However, poor installation and inadequate coatings can shorten that lifespan significantly.
